Who is Lanham Napier?
Lanham Napier joined Rackspace Managed Hosting as chief financial officer in April, 2000, just a few short months before
the technology industry hit rock bottom during the 2000 downturn. He is largely credited by Rackspace's own management
team in keeping the company steady and setting it on its current path to profitability and success.
In January of 2001, Lanham was named president of the company, working side-by-side with CEO Graham Weston as they pulled
the company out of a cash-burning mode and established an operational discipline that set it on a permanent positive
revenue track. In 2006, he was named chief executive officer, further underscoring his key role at the company.
Early in his career, Lanham worked as an analyst for Merrill Lynch
Co. from May of 1993 to June of 1995. Then prior to coming to
Rackspace, he served as a director for Silver Brands Partners, a San
Antonio investment firm.
Immediately after joining Rackspace, Napier recognized that customer service was at the very core of Rackspace's business
and helped introduce the 'fanatical customer support' culture for which Rackspace is known today. His efforts went into
instilling a deep concern for and interest in the customer at every level of the company, rewarding positive behavior and
quarterly growth, as well as customer acquisition and retention. Despite the discipline, Rackspace is regularly cited
locally and nationally as one of 'the best places to work.'
During his tenure, Lanham has seen the company grow from less than 100 employees to more than 1,000, and from a single data
center to eight facilities located in Texas, Washington, D.C, and London, England.
Lanham has a B.A. in Economics from Rice University and an M.B.A. from Harvard University.
